The Upfitting Work Deposit definition

The Upfitting Work Deposit is applicable to the "landlord work" described by the tenant leases for the collective work described in Exhibit A attached hereto and made a part hereof and for the payments of any unpaid construction allowance which may be due to Verizon Wireless. Buyer shall be entitled to draw down the Upfitting Work Deposit to pay for the landlord work and said construction allowances. The balance of the Upfitting Work Deposit, if any, after the completion of the landlord work shall be released by Escrow Agent to Seller upon the joint direction of Seller and Buyer.
